Transaction 34f70c8a73f1f127ba34d29efc7f32ca29efdd6c5cf92454fbe5ff3f8fba715b

1 Input
2 Outputs
  • 34f70c8a73f1f127ba34d29efc7f32ca29efdd6c5cf92454fbe5ff3f8fba715b:0
  • value  17263842
    address  17H6WnCbERKEHuHFP4fQ9B2ui9BiMFr8eH
  • 34f70c8a73f1f127ba34d29efc7f32ca29efdd6c5cf92454fbe5ff3f8fba715b:1
  • value  1135043375
    address  3BAL2EvPvYqBnB4XL31bVitykDe2qkxChe